Three of New York City's finest recording artists perform together on the same stage in the first-ever Engine Company Records label showcase. Melissa Giges and David Cloyd will be celebrating the worldwide release of their debut albums, joined by national recording artist and ECR founder Blake Morgan, who will debut new songs from his forthcoming album and perform fan favorites. Backed by a full band, all three artists will be sharing the stage, performing their songs as a triple-bill.
MELISSA GIGES
Melissa Giges has already stepped into the national spotlight with the success of her first single, "Before I'm Barely Seen," featured in both the TV ads and the season premiere of MTV's The Real World: Brooklyn. The song, from her debut album Evident, is now the fastest selling track in ECR history. DAVID CLOYD
Unhand Me, You Fiend!, Cloyd's debut album, has already hit #1 on eMusic's Album Charts. eMusic is the world's largest retailer of independent music and the world's second-largest digital music retailer overall. Other notable artists on the chart include Radiohead, Vampire Weekend, A.C. Newman, Bon Iver, Andrew Bird, and Sigur Ros. BLAKE MORGAN
Billboard Magazine writes, "Morgan has a voice that was made to be heard on the radio." Now, Blake Morgan returns to the stage to debut never-before-heard songs, as well as perform fan favorites from his albums Anger's Candy, Burning Daylight, and Silencer. "Maverick recording artist, producer, and multi-instrumentalist Blake Morgan's studio chops, smart lyrics, and gift for the melodic twist have earned him a loyal critical and commercial following." —All Music Guide
